What are the 7 layers of OSI

7 Application


6 Presentation


5 Session


4 Transport


3 Network


2 Data Link


1 Physical

OSI Presentation Layer 6

The Layer presents data for the application or network

OSI Layer 5 Session

Two devices speak to each other a session is created that setups, coordinates and terminates between applications

OSI Layer 4 Transport

How much data to send, at what rate, where it goes etc. example (TCP) Transmission Control Protocol

OSI Layer 3 Network

Router functionality: packet forwarding, including routing through different routers. helps plan the route efficiently.

OSI Layer 2 Data Link

node to node data transfer, error corrections from physical layer

OSI Layer 1 Physical

Cables in routers, switches or computers. layouts of pins and voltages and other physical arrangements

Protocol Data Unit (PDU)

refers to a group of information added or removed by a layer of the OSI model.


Contains control info, address info or data
